Empowering Indian SMEs: Google Cloud Unveils Gen AI Vision at Next ’24

Generative AI Poised to Break Barriers and Transform Inventory Management for India’s Entrepreneurs”

In a groundbreaking revelation at Google Cloud Next ’24, Will Grannis, Vice President and Chief Technology Officer at Google Cloud, emphasized the transformative potential of generative AI for small businesses in India. Speaking at a media roundtable during the event held in Las Vegas, Grannis highlighted the pivotal role of AI in dismantling barriers to market access and streamlining inventory management for entrepreneurs.

Grannis articulated, “I believe that generative AI, particularly in the context of India and its small enterprises, will be profoundly impactful. It will eliminate hurdles associated with entering new markets and alleviate the burden of inventory creation, a significant risk for businesses.”

Reflecting on his visit to India during Google I/O in 2023, Grannis underscored the burgeoning trend of cloud adoption among small-scale ventures in the country.

“I had the opportunity to witness firsthand some of the initial applications of cloud technology by small businesses, including individual artisans navigating the AI landscape. Previously, such entities would grapple with the challenge of inventory management, attempting to anticipate customer preferences and market demands,” Grannis elaborated.

He elucidated the transformative potential of generative AI, elucidating how businesses can leverage AI models to effortlessly generate diverse product variations based on natural language instructions, without the need for extensive datasets or technical expertise.
